Your Morning Calm - Guided Meditation
A gentle morning meditation designed to be done at the kitchen table with your cup of tea or coffee. This practice helps you settle into the day with presence and kindness, using simple breath awareness, a brief visualisation of your day ahead, and three quiet affirmations to carry with you.

ABOUT STEVEN WEBB
Steven Webb is a meditation teacher, podcaster, politician, and the host of Inner Peace Meditations. A former mayor of Truro in the county of Cornwall, Steven continues to split his time between politics and the contemplative work he is best known for. After a life-changing accident left him paralysed from the chest down, he found his way to inner peace through mindfulness, Zen philosophy, and the teachings of Alan Watts and Shunryu Suzuki. He now helps others find calm and resilience — especially those who find meditation difficult. Steven lives in Cornwall, England and shares his work at stevenwebb.com.
